The Long And Winding Road Concludes Saturday

RMU Game Notes (12.2.17)

GAME 8
Robert Morris (4-3) @ Siena (1-5)
Saturday, December 2, 2017 • 2:00 p.m.
Times Union Center (17,500) • Albany, N.Y.

Radio: ESPN 970 AM & 106.3 FM
Radio Talent: Chris Shovlin (pxp) & Jim Elias (color)
Video: TBD
 
Quick Hits

 
- The Robert Morris University men's basketball team, winners of four consecutive games, opens December by concluding an eight-game road trip to open its 2017-18 slate with a 2:00 p.m. tip against Siena in Albany, N.Y., at the Times Union Center.
 
- RMU, with a record of 4-3 (.571), is assured of having arguably one of its best road trips in program history. To open the 1993-94 season, the Colonials finished an eight-game road swing 2-6 (.250), while Robert Morris christened its 1990-91 schedule with a 3-6 (.333) mark in nine straight road games to open the year.
 
- Through seven games of its season-opening eight-game road trip, Robert Morris has traveled 6,888 miles (round trip) and played in all four time zones (Eastern, Central, Mountain and Pacific).
 
-  During its four-game winning streak, RMU is holding opponents to an average of 62.5 points per game. Opponents are also averaging 20.25 turnovers over the past four games.
 
- The Colonials extended their winning streak to four with an 81-74 victory @ Youngstown State (11/29/17). Sophomore guard Dachon Burke led five players in double figures against the Penguins with a career-high 21 points and also added nine rebounds, four steals and a pair of blocks.
 
- Junior guard Matty McConnell added 18 points, six boards and four assists in the win over the Penguins, while freshman forward Koby Thomas notched 11 points and four boards. A pair of rookies also registered their first double-figure scoring game in the win @ Youngstown State, as freshman guard Jon Williams scored 11 points to go along with five assists and freshman forward Charles Bain scored 10 points off the bench.
 
- Robert Morris concluded play in the Grand Canyon Classic with a 78-64 victory @ Little Rock (11/25/17). Sophomore guard Dachon Burke was one of four players to reach double figures in scoring against the Trojans, registering a game-high 17 points to go along with eight rebounds and three assists.
 
- Freshman forward Koby Thomas and junior guard Matty McConnell each scored 15 points in the win @ Little Rock (11/25/17), while freshman guard Leondre Washington supplied 12 points off the bench. Thomas also grabbed nine rebounds.
 
- RMU posted a 75-53 victory over Norfolk State (11/24/17) in the first of two games at the Jack Stephens Center in Little Rock, Ark., as part of the Grand Canyon Classic. In 25 minutes, freshman forward Koby Thomas scored a game-high 21 points on 9-for-10 shooting from the field, including a 3-for-4 performance from beyond the arc.
 
- Freshman guard Leondre Washington contributed 16 points and five assists off the bench in the win over the Spartans, while sophomore guard Dachon Burke registered 15 points, five assists and a pair of steals.

Youngstown State Tidbits - Robert Morris snapped a four-game slide against the Penguins with the victory and improved to 10-8 (.556) all-time against Youngstown State ... Of the 18 meetings between the two programs, 13 have been decided by eight points or less, including five by three points or fewer ... YSU shot just 18.8 percent (3-for-16) from beyond the arc, a season low by an RMU opponent ... The Colonials recorded a season-high seven blocks, including three by junior forward Malik Petteway ... The Penguins held a 33-32 edge in rebounding ... Youngstown State was the first opponent on RMU's 2017-18 schedule to finish with fewer turnovers (14) than Robert Morris (19).
 
A Team Effort - Robert Morris has been playing complete basketball during its four-game winning streak, and the proof is in the digits. During the surge, the Colonials are outscoring their opponents by a margin of +12.5, own a turnover margin of +2.5 and have outrebounded opponents by a +6.8 margin. RMU has also held each of its last four foes to a shooting percentage of just 30.5 percent (18-for-59) from beyond the arc.
 
Blast Off - Dachon Burke led the way in an 81-74 win @ Youngstown State (11/29/17), scoring a career-high 21 points for Robert Morris to go along with nine rebounds, four steals and two blocks. The reigning NEC Player of the Week, Burke has scored in double figures in each of his six games this season. During RMU's four-game winning streak, Burke is averaging a team-high 16.0 points per contest while shooting 51.1 percent (23-for-45) from the field. He is also producing averages of 7.5 rebounds,  2.5 steals and 2.3 assists per game.
 
Depth Charge - Charles Bain was one of five Colonials to score in double figures in an 81-74 victory @ Youngstown State (11/29/17), as the rookie forward registered the first double-scoring game of his career with 10 points. Getting production from its bench has been a key for Robert Morris during its four-game winning streak, as reserves are averaging 24.0 points per game. RMU has received at least 20 points from its bench in each of its last six games entering Saturday's tilt @ Siena and overall this season the bench is averaging 23.4 points per contest.
 
On The Offensive - Thanks to a shooting percentage of 53.1 percent (26-for-49) in an 81-74 victory @ Youngstown State (11/29/17), RMU improved to 38-5 (.884) when shooting 50 percent or better from the field in eight seasons under head coach Andrew Toole, including a mark of 29-1 (.967) against NEC opponents. Broken down against league foes, Robert Morris is 26-1 (.963) in the regular season and 3-0 in the NEC Tournament when converting at least half of its shots.
 
Did You Know? In seven seasons under head coach Andrew Toole, Robert Morris has compiled a record of 81-32 (.717) when scoring at least 70 points in a game. Included in that record is a mark of 29-4 (.879) when eclipsing the 80-point plateau.
 
Free Is For Me - Robert Morris stretched its winning streak to four in an 81-74 victory @ Youngstown State (11/29/17) by visiting the free-throw line a season-high 33 times, converting 22 of those attempts (66.7%). Getting to the charity stripe at least 30 times in a game is a good sign for the Colonials. RMU owns a record of 28-10 (.737) under head coach Andrew Toole when visiting the chalk at least 30 times in a contest.

Keep On Rockin ... Robert Morris closes out an eight-game road trip to open its 2017-18 season @ Siena (12/2/17), and the Times Union Center will become the 15th arena that the Colonials have played in that has also featured a concert by Pearl Jam since the band's formation in 1990. Also included is John Paul Jones Arena (Charlottesville, Va.), PPG Paints Arena (Pittsburgh, Pa.), the Pan American Center (Las Cruces, N.M.), Time Warner Cable Arena (Charlotte, N.C.), The L.A. Sports Arena (Los Angeles, Calif.), the Verizon Center (Washington, D.C.), the FedExForum (Memphis, Tenn.), Rupp Arena (Lexington, Ky.), the Palace at Auburn Hills (Detroit, Mich.), the Prudential Center (Newark, N.J.), Savage Arena (Toledo, Ohio), the Wolstein Center (Cleveland, Ohio), the Bryce Jordan Center (State College, Pa.) and A.J. Palumbo Center (Pittsburgh, Pa.).
